-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as 1971 All England Badminton Championships – men's doubles[17].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as 1973 All England Badminton Championships – men's doubles[18].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as badminton at the 1970 Asian Games – men's doubles[19].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as 1971 Asian Badminton Championships – men's doubles[20].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as badminton at the 1970 Asian Games – men's team[21].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as 1970 Singapore Open Badminton Championships – men's doubles[22].
- Indra Gunawan's participant in is recorded as 1973 Singapore Open Badminton Championships – men's doubles[23].
